NBA Preview: Oklahoma City Thunder vs. Houston Rockets

The fans at Toyota Center will be treated to a game between the Oklahoma City Thunder and the Houston Rockets when they take their seats on Wednesday.

Oddsmakers currently have the Thunder listed as 4-point favorites versus the Rockets, while the game's total is sitting at 201.

The Thunder were a 111-85 winner in their most recent outing at home against the Jazz. They covered the 12-point spread as favorites, while the total score (196) made winners of UNDER bettors.

Houston lost its last outing, a 93-83 result against the Grizzlies on February 14. The Rockets failed to cover in that game as a 3-point underdog, while the 176 combined points took the game UNDER the total.
